Comprehensive Definitions & Senses

2 senses
As noun
  1. 1

    An employee whose job is to deal with people arriving at an office or hotel, answering the telephone, and giving information to visitors.

    "The receptionist greeted the clients and asked them to take a seat in the waiting area."
  2. 2

    A person stationed at a reception desk in a professional setting to manage incoming communications and schedules.

    "She worked for three years as a medical receptionist before being promoted to office manager."

Linguistic Origin & Historical Etymology

Derived from the verb 'reception', stemming from the Latin 'receptio' (a receiving), via Middle French. The suffix '-ist' was added in the 19th century to denote a person who performs a specific occupation or action.
